Satay On The Road used to be a spot where we enjoyed going to and getting take out from but in recent time it has gone down hill. Where do I start? Take out was suppose to be picked up in 30 minutes but when we arrived and were told it would be 5-10 minutes more and then continued to be 5-10 minutes for the next half an hour. I understand restaurants can become backed up but give your clients the respect to provide a realistic timeframe. The disappointment continued with the food being bland and the noodles dishes were over cooked. Regrettably they send mix messages about what is coming with the curry dishes, all images in the menu show the curry with rice. This is missleading, you have to order the rice separately. I have never had a Thai curry not come with rice. If you don't supply something with the dish don't show images with it.Overall I am not sure I will be going back here and it looks like others agree.
